Now, I'm not sure about the Sony reader but the Amazon Kindle does own a "Read-to-Me" feature which does what it say: reads stuff aloud, however this is lone if the book's rights holder has the feature available.

I own niether but the Amazon Kindle seems to be better as it allows for not a moment ago books but Newspapers and Magazines to be downloaded.
